Comments

A 17-year-old boy had a slowly growing mass on the back of his neck for 5 years. Examination revealed a soft spongy 7 cm mass with well defined slippery borders situated at the nape of the neck. Skin over the swelling appeared normal and was pinchable. Fine needle aspiration cytology showed clusters of mature adipocytes in an oily background.There were no lipoblasts. Cytological features were suggestive of Lipoma. This was confirmed by histopathological examination of the excised specimen.
